Vice President of Research & Engineering About Nxera Pharma
Nxera Pharma is establishing a new AI enabled discovery initiative to build a high throughput AI and physics driven GPCR discovery engine that augments our world class experimental capabilities and extensive proprietary structural and chemogenomic data assets originating from Heptares Therapeutics. This initiative sits within our newly formed Computational Sciences team alongside Research Informatics, Chem Informatics and Bio Informatics. AI is being deployed across the NxWaveTM platform, trained on the industry’s most extensive proprietary GPCR structure–ligand dataset and paired with our curated chemogenomic library of GPCR focused small molecules.
Our mission is to unlock the vast untapped potential of G-protein-coupled receptors (GPCRs) using computational and experimental innovation to design first-in-class therapeutics across metabolic, neurological, immunological, and rare diseases.
